Scuba Diving Conditions
- Certain medical conditions (diabetes, asthma etc.) and medications may preclude some people from scuba diving.
- Please see our Dive Safety Page for more information.
- Minimum age for diving is 12 years.
- Flying after diving: A wait of 12 hours is recommended by preferably 24 hours, if doing multiple dives, before ascending to an altitude of 300 metres or greater.
- Certified divers must possess an internationally recognised SCUBA certificate card.

Itinerary

From
07:30
Check-in at the Quicksilver Cruises office at the Port Douglas Marina for your boarding passes.
08:00
Vessel boarding. Complimentary morning tea/breakfast served.
08:30
Depart Port Douglas Marina for the Outer Reef. On the outward journey, certified and introductory dive briefings begin.
10:15
Arrive at the first Agincourt Reef site. Divers gear up, while snorkellers' site briefing begins. Get ready to view the beauty of this natural wonder!
11:30
Silversonic departs for second reef location. Option for introductory divers and certified divers to do a second dive. Snorkellers site briefing.
12:00
Tropical hot and cold buffet lunch served in the air conditioned cabin.
13:40
Silversonic departs for third reef location. Snorkellers are once again briefed as to the best areas to snorkel and Guided Snorkel Tour. Option for certified divers to do a third dive or second introductory dive.
14:30
Afternoon tea served.
14:50
All passengers board vessel for final passenger count.
15:00
Silversonic commences return journey to Port Douglas.
16:30
Silversonic arrives at the Port Douglas Marina.
16:55
Coaches depart for accommodation.
Times may vary subject to sites visited: On rare occasions, services can be subject to the effect of weather or unforeseen circumstances requiring changes to the scheduled itinerary and the number of sites visited.

Guided Great Barrier Reef Scuba Diving & Snorkelling

GI Aerial

Imagine entering a vibrant underwater kingdom teeming with exotic marine life. Silversonic visits a rich tapestry of remote and exclusive World Heritage Great Barrier Reef sites at the renowned Agincourt ribbon reefs. With incredible coral formations and extreme biodiversity, this is quality diving and snorkelling.

Silversonic also has an exclusive permit to swim with dwarf minke whale if encountered – a truly unforgettable experience!

All dives on board Silversonic are guided by an experienced PADI-certified dive instructor to ensure the absolute best & safest diving or snorkelling experience on the Great Barrier Reef.

Designed for Comfort

Luxurious, Modern & Fast

Sleek, smooth and sun-kissed, with Silversonic you'll travel in comfort and style - the perfect base for an inspirational day of exciting aqua-tivities.

As pioneers of Great Barrier Reef cruising, Quicksilver has infused over 40 years of experience into designing these exceptional sisterships producing the perfect balance of comfort, style and function. Silverswift and Silversonic are modern, spacious 29 metre high speed catamarans, custom-designed to help you get the best out of your day.

  • State-of-the-art computerised ride control systems mean a smoother ride to the reef.

  • Hydraulic platforms for easy water access.

  • Change rooms and hot freshwater showers.

  • Spacious sundecks, air conditioned lounge areas and a licensed bar.

  • The latest dive and snorkel equipment.

  • Cruising at speed, we spend less time getting there which means more time at the reef for you.

  • For the comfort of all, Silverswift and Silversonic are non-smoking vessels.
